About this experience

Make the most of your stay in Gdańsk with a fully customizable private sightseeing ride through the city’s most iconic landmarks and historic streets. Travel comfortably as your Welcomer shares local insights and stories about Gdańsk’s important role in European history. Begin in Gdańsk Old Town (Main Town), where colorful buildings and historic streets reflect the city’s rich trading heritage. Continue to Long Market (Długi Targ), a lively area known for its elegant architecture and vibrant atmosphere. Next, visit the Neptune Fountain, one of the city’s best-known symbols of its maritime past, followed by St. Mary’s Church, a striking example of Gothic architecture. End at the Motława River and historic Crane (Żuraw), where the waterfront showcases Gdańsk’s legacy as a major Baltic port. Your experience finishes with a convenient drop-off at your accommodation, ideal for travelers seeking a complete introduction to Gdańsk’s history, architecture, and atmosphere.

What you'll see and do

  1. Gdansk

    Gdańsk Old Town (Main Town). A beautifully restored historic center with colorful facades and rich merchant history.

    20 minutes here

  2. Dlugi Targ Square

    Long Market (Długi Targ). The city’s main street lined with iconic buildings and lively atmosphere.

    20 minutes here

  3. Neptune Fountain. A symbol of Gdańsk located in the heart of the Old Town.

    20 minutes here

  4. St. Mary's Church

    St. Mary’s Church. One of the largest brick churches in the world with impressive Gothic architecture.

    30 minutes here

  5. Crane

    Motława River & Crane (Żuraw) A historic waterfront area featuring Gdańsk’s famous medieval port crane.

    30 minutes here
